vimarsana.com

Top Locations Tagged with Technical Support Solutions

Technical Support Solutions in United States - 34474/Local-service near Marion

1). Technical Support Solutions

Technical Support Solutions in Puerto Rico - 33166/Computer-products near Miami Dade

2). Technical Support Solutions, NW Th ST

Technical Support Solutions in United States - 35068/Computer-service near Jefferson

3). Technical Support Solutions, Stouts Rd

Technical Support Solutions in Australia - /Software-company near New Cntry West

4). Technical Support Solutions Orange Nsw Australia

vimarsana © 2020. All Rights Reserved.